The Importance of Door Seals
Door seals are designed to create an airtight barrier between the door and its frame. This barrier serves numerous essential functions:
Energy Efficiency: Properly sealed doors prevent cold air from entering and warm air from leaving, reducing the workload on heating and cooling systems. This can cause significant energy savings and lower utility bills.Comfort: Drafts can make an area unpleasant, particularly during severe weather conditions. Seals assist keep a constant temperature, improving the general comfort of a space.Security: Seals can discourage burglars by making it more difficult to pry open a door.Sound Reduction: Seals can assist shut out external noise, developing a quieter and more tranquil environment.Prevention of Pests: Seals can avoid insects and little animals from entering a building, which is particularly crucial in areas with high bug activity.Indications That It's Time to Replace Your Door Seals
Recognizing when your door seals require replacement is vital for preserving the efficiency of your doors. Here are some signs to look out for:
Drafts: If you can feel cold air being available in or warm air leaving around the door, it's a clear indication that the seals are not working correctly.Visible Wear: Inspect the seals for signs of wear and tear, such as fractures, tears, or spaces. If the material is fragile or has actually lost its flexibility, it's time to change it.Energy Bills: A sudden boost in your energy bills, particularly during winter or summer, can be a sign that your seals are not offering appropriate insulation.Problem in Closing the Door: If the door is challenging to close or latch, it could be due to damaged seals that are no longer providing the required compression.Water Leaks: If water is seeping through the door during rain, it's an indication that the seals are not efficiently sealing the gaps.Step-by-Step Guide to Replacing Door Seals
Changing door seals is a reasonably simple process that can be made with basic tools. Here's a detailed guide to assist you through the process:

Gather Materials and Tools:
New door seals (weatherstripping)Utility knifeScrewdriverMeasuring tapeAdhesive (if needed)Cleaning cloth
Get Rid Of the Old Seals:
Start by getting rid of the old seals. If they are kept in location with screws, use a screwdriver to eliminate them. If they are adhesive, use an utility knife to thoroughly cut them far from the door frame.Tidy the location where the new seals will be set up to make sure a strong bond.
Measure and Cut the New Seals:
Measure the length of the door frame where the seals will be installed. Cut the brand-new seals to the proper length utilizing an energy knife. It's important to guarantee that the seals fit comfortably with no spaces.
Set Up the New Seals:
Apply adhesive to the composite back Door Repair of the new seals if they are not self-adhesive. Follow the maker's instructions for the very best results.Location the brand-new seals in the suitable positions on the door frame. Make sure that they are aligned properly and press them strongly into location.If the seals are held in location with screws, utilize a screwdriver to secure them.
Evaluate the Door:
Close the door and look for any gaps or drafts. If the seals are not providing a tight seal, you might need to adjust their position or replace them with a different type of seal.Evaluate the door to ensure it opens and closes efficiently. If there is any resistance, you might need to trim the seals a little.
Final Touches:
Once you are satisfied with the setup, clean up any excess adhesive or debris.Regularly check the seals to ensure they remain in excellent condition.Frequently Asked Questions About Door Seal Replacement
Q: How typically should I replace my door seals?A: The lifespan of door seals can differ depending upon the product and environmental conditions. Generally, seals should be replaced every 5-10 years. Nevertheless, if you discover any indications of wear or drafts, it's best to change them quicker.

Q: Can I replace door seals myself, or should I work with a professional?A: Replacing door seals is a DIY-friendly job that can be completed with fundamental tools. However, if you are unsure about the process or if the seals become part of a complicated door system, it might be best to consult a professional.

Q: What are the different kinds of door seals offered?A: There are several kinds of door seals, consisting of:
V-Seals: These are V-shaped strips that offer a tight seal and are easy to install.T-Seals: These have a T-shaped profile and are perfect for doors that require a strong seal.Felt Seals: These are soft and versatile, making them suitable for doors with irregular spaces.Foam Seals: These are made of foam and are reliable at blocking drafts and noise.
Q: How much does it cost to replace door seals?A: The expense of changing door seals can differ depending upon the type of seal and the size of the door. On average, products can cost in between ₤ 10 and ₤ 50 per door. If you employ a professional, the expense can range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150 per door, consisting of labor.

Q: Can door seals improve the energy efficiency of my home?A: Yes, door seals can considerably improve the energy performance of your home by preventing air leakages. This can lead to lower cooling and heating expenses and a more comfortable living environment.
